Output dbb955ca32570264c3063382ea9ecd6c9c4165177eac1a4bb274a1b407f182a4:1

value
5922347
script pubkey
OP_0 OP_PUSHBYTES_20 3abf6665085a31d7d6b8d44d1d5c398e7a36ee05
address
bc1q82lkveggtgca044c63x36hpe3eardms9n7l82g
transaction
dbb955ca32570264c3063382ea9ecd6c9c4165177eac1a4bb274a1b407f182a4
confirmations
333974
spent
true